Key Headlines Impacting Johnson & Johnson
Here are the key news stories impacting Johnson & Johnson this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Pipeline and product expansion support long-term growth. J&J received FDA clearance for its surgical robot and is targeting $100 billion in revenue. The company also raised its dividend for the 64th consecutive year, reinforcing its appeal to income-oriented investors. FDA clearance, dividend and revenue article
- Positive Sentiment: Oncology and immunology efforts gained momentum. J&J completed its $1 billion acquisition of Firefly Bio, adding a degrader antibody-conjugate platform, and formed a Sail Biomedicines partnership focused on in-vivo CAR-T therapies. The agreement includes $785 million in initial payments and an option to acquire Sail for $2.58 billion. J&J biotech deals article
- Positive Sentiment: Analyst sentiment remains favorable. Argus Research initiated coverage with a Buy rating, while Erste Group raised its 2026 EPS estimate to $11.68 from $11.56. Recent analyst targets remain broadly above the current trading range. Argus Buy rating article
- Neutral Sentiment: Regulatory progress could expand the pharmaceutical franchise. The FDA granted Priority Review to subcutaneous RYBREVANT FASPRO for advanced head and neck cancer. The treatment produced a 42% overall response rate in clinical data, but approval and commercial uptake remain uncertain. RYBREVANT FASPRO Priority Review article
- Negative Sentiment: Near-term earnings face pressure from strategic spending. J&J lowered its 2026 profit forecast, citing the Firefly acquisition and Sail collaboration. The upfront cash commitments may weigh on earnings and raise questions about the return on those investments. Reuters profit forecast article
- Negative Sentiment: The proposed talc settlement remains a major financial liability. J&J would commit $5.5 billion to resolve approximately 76,000 ovarian-cancer claims, subject to at least 95% claimant participation. Investors appear to be shifting attention from reduced legal uncertainty to the size and execution risk of the cash obligation. Talc settlement article

Johnson & Johnson is a multinational healthcare company headquartered in New Brunswick, New Jersey, that develops, manufactures and markets a broad range of products across pharmaceuticals, medical devices and previously consumer health. Founded in 1886 by the Johnson family, the company has grown into a global healthcare organization with operations and sales in many countries around the world.
The company's pharmaceuticals business, organized largely under its Janssen research and development organization, focuses on prescription medicines across therapeutic areas such as immunology, infectious disease, oncology and neuroscience.
